hello all,
This is my first time in the forum we have recently purchased a 16.49.1 towed by a Disco 3 tdv6 had our first trip away to Whitfield in the King Valley up the Hume to Glenrowan then home over to Mansfield etc every thing was fantastic except the under slung spare tire carriers scraps not every time but enough to be annoying .

My thoughts are that I could cut the existing carrier and raise it up to the bottom of the chassis frame but this would mean I have to move the tire forward
Any help or thoughts on this would be very greatly appreciated

Welcome Stephen. You are among friends here. Raising the spare in the A frame would be difficult especially as you say it will have to be moved forward. There have been a number of ideas from members such as a rear mount on a heavier bar or under sling the spare behind the axle with a wind down setup as used in utes. Have a look at this link,

Thanks for your warm welcome all sorted regarding the spare tire issue and speed humps around Eltham Vic spoke with Jayco and its OK to cut the cradle away I was concerned that wiring might run from one side to the other , I can lift the tyre and move it forward and this won't impact on the ball weight
So all's good and thanks for the advise
